Pink Floyd fans to be treated to rocking experience at Brit Floyd concert

The Des Moines Civic Center will be transformed into a Pink Floyd concert on Sunday when the tribute group Brit Floyd takes the stage.

Brit Floyd concert-goers will be treated to a true Pink Floyd experience thanks to a state-of-the-art million dollar light and video show while listening to some of the group’s greatest hits like “Comfortably Numb,” “Wish You Were Here” and “Another Brick in the Wall.”

Leading Brit Floyd on guitar and vocals is Damian Darlington, who started the group more than five ago. Darlington is a long-time fan of Pink Floyd’s music, and prior to starting Brit Floyd toured with another Pink Floyd tribute band for 17 years.

"We try to recreate a Pink Floyd show on as large of a scale as we can," said Darlington, who started playing guitar as a young teenager. "There is a level of detail we put into things with the light show, videos and a huge amount of attention to detail to have the show put on correctly."
That attention to detail has been bringing Pink Floyd and classic rock fans to Brit Floyd concerts from Spain to France, London to the U.S. Darlington said the group has noticed the crowds get younger and younger with each world tour.

“A lot of people in the crowd were around when their first albums came out, but now there is a whole new generation that wants to experience (Pink Floyd),” he said. “People are bringing their children and now their grandchildren to experience it and enjoy the music.”

With playing some of the world’s most recognizable tunes, Darlington said there is a certain amount of pressure the band feels when taking the stage.

“There is a little bit of pressure on yourself but we just try harder. We take the music very seriously,” Darlington said. “I’m proud of what Brit Floyd has done. I take pride in what we do.”

That pride shows during Brit Floyd shows which features Pink Floyd staples as well as more obscure tracks from the rock group’s five decades of music. Darlington said Brit Floyd’s video and light show really brings the Pink Floyd music to life.

“Our show brings a level of immersion of all senses,” he said.  “Pink Floyd is known for putting on large-scale multimedia concerts. They were really a pioneer at that sort of thing. We are very passionate about the music and what we do.”
